Как я могу отправить один и тот же трафик в две разные VLAN в одной подсети? [закрыто]

У нас есть поток данных, поступающий на один сервер Linux (CentOS 7). Нам нужен этот сервер для пересылки всех данных в две разные VLAN с одной и той же подсетью. В настоящее время у нас есть программное обеспечение, работающее на сервере, которое может зеркалировать данные в двух разных подсетях, но оно не поддерживает VLAN (поскольку VLAN реализованы по проприетарному протоколу Cisco), поэтому нам необходимо настроить сервер на уровне ОС для зеркалирования данных. из двух отдельных интерфейсов. Есть ли способ настроить Linux на это? (Все соединения - IP через TCP)

Одним из решений является изменение подсети для одной из VLAN, однако это может вызвать простои, которых мы бы предпочли не иметь.

-1
задан 24 August 2017 в 12:45
1 ответ

«две разные VLAN с одной и той же подсетью» - как в «IP-подсети»? Это создает проблему маршрутизации, которую нетривиально решить.

Если вы используете маршрутизатор для пересылки в разные VLAN, маршрутизатор должен разделить подсеть на более мелкие подсети, т. Е. для адресов 192.168.1.3 и 192.168.1.5 вы разделяете на 192.168.1.0/30 и 192.168.1.4/30.

Если вы напрямую подключаете виртуальные локальные сети к серверу, вам необходимо сделать то же самое с привязкой IP-адреса сетевого адаптера.

1
ответ дан 5 December 2019 в 19:42

Теги

Похожие вопросы